Description Hadriscus 2023-10-11 03:01:53 UTC
Description:
Scrolling in LibreOffice Writer using a trackpad, either in a document, in preferences or in a list (such as the font selector), is so fast that a few increments (representing roughly two millimeters on the trackpad) covers an entire page. It is effectively unusable. In order to match other programs, this sensitivity would have to be cut down by quite a lot -probably a factor of seven or eight, by my own approximation.

I am using a Lenovo Legion from 2020 if that is any help. I'm inclined to think this is unrelated to the hardware however.
